Obama On A Roll
President Barack Obama is on a roll. Here’s what happened on his watch the past week:
- Osama bin Laden was killed with a bullet to the head.
- The federal government’s reaction to the devastating tornado in Alabama was quick, decisive and organized getting immediate relief and help to the people in need.
- He pushed back on Donald Trump by releasing his long-form birth certificate (a move I opposed) and mocked the egomaniac at the White House correspondents dinner. NBC interrupted Trump’s “Celebrity Apprentice” to break the news to America about the killing of Osama bin Laden.
